Kilbirnie Community Football Club
Background
KCFC was officially launched on 24 May 2006 with the following objectives: • To increase access to sports and leisure opportunities for the
inhabitants of Kilbirnie and the surrounding areas;
• To develop a player pathway for local sport and leisure, thereby encouraging a more positive and healthy lifestyle for today's society; and
• To develop social education programs that reflect the principles and policies of the club, to assist in building a safe and strong community.
Kilbirnie Community Football Club
Key milestones to date: • Quality Mark – Development Level – November 2006;
• Club website developed – January 2007;
• Compound/Portable goals installed – September 2008;
• Quality Mark – Community Level – December 2008;
Kilbirnie Community Football Club
• Introduction of KCFC Charter which all applicable teams have signed up to – July 2010;
• Soccer School launched – May 2011;
• Mum’s team launched – June 2012;
• Increase in number of playing teams from 9 (2006) to 15 (2013)
• Quality Mark – Legacy Level – May 2013

Kilbirnie Community Football Club
Current Club Initiatives
• New under 6’s team each year;
• Youth section (8 teams) and Girls section covering up to under 13 age group;
• Links to Adult game
– Over 35s / Over 55s;
– Amateurs – Kilbirnie AFC;
– Juniors – Kilbirnie Ladeside FC;
Kilbirnie Community Football Club
• Soccer School including Mini-Kickers and Night League programme;
• Gift Aid programme;
• Multi team development coaching;
• Winter Futsal
• Soccer Camps during school holidays – Easter and Summer (3);
Kilbirnie Community Football Club
• Community Fun Day each August;
• Christmas come and play day;
• Community Initiative Programme;
• Mum’s team;
• Goalkeeping coaching;
